Why Sink Bib Taps Remain a Popular Choice
Sink Bib Taps are designed to offer straightforward water control for spaces like utility rooms, garages, and outdoor areas. These taps typically include a simple lever or wheel handle and a robust spout designed to handle frequent use.
Durability is a central consideration in sink bib taps. Constructed from materials such as brass or stainless steel, these taps resist wear from water exposure and environmental conditions. Their simple mechanisms also contribute to easier repairs if needed.
The threaded spout design facilitates easy hose attachment, making these taps valuable for outdoor watering tasks and cleaning operations. Some sink bib taps include freeze-resistant features suitable for colder climates.
Mounting options are varied, with wall-mounted bib taps common in outdoor settings, while floor or sink-mounted versions fit indoor utility spaces. Considerations such as water pressure compatibility and handle ergonomics can improve user experience.
Maintenance of sink bib taps involves regular cleaning to prevent mineral buildup and occasional lubrication of moving parts. These taps often have fewer internal components than other fixtures, simplifying upkeep.
As practical fixtures, sink bib taps provide consistent water access for various tasks, from gardening to washing tools. Their straightforward design and reliable performance make them a valuable addition to many households.
